Description Marc Doughty 2004-02-19 08:28:13 UTC
Current headers packages are maxed out at 2.6.1, I'd like to take advantage of the updates to the kernel since then. Can 2.6.3 be dropped into portage? I'm trying to 'push ahead' and find bugs with NPTL.
Comment 1 Tim Yamin (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2004-02-19 15:42:19 UTC
Fixed in CVS, it should be with you in Portage within an hour. Thanks!
Comment 2 Tim Yamin (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2004-02-19 16:24:55 UTC
You might want to run another rsync if you've installed 2.6.3 already since it seems that the upstream kernel devs broke byteorder.h on X86 with the "__attribute_const__" thing. Fixed in CVS, so it should be in Portage within an hour, so just merge your headers again after you've synced.
